Union claims half of bus drivers isolating after some positive tests

Unite says 40 members affected

Around half of the Island's bus drivers are self-isolating after a number tested positive for Covid-19. 

That's according to Unite the Union which says around 40 of its members are affected

A restricted timetable is currently in place – last week the bus service also went contactless in a move to protect passengers and drivers.
